    Manchester’s Store Retail Group partners with Costcutter

    Mital Morar, founder of Store Retail Group

    Costcutter Supermarkets Group has sealed a new long-term trading partnership with Store Retail Group (SRG), which currently operates six stores across the Manchester region.

    The deal will see Costcutter providing central and direct to store supply for the group’s stores which include the General Store and Foodhall brands.

    The SRG, led by retailer Mital Morar, will also get support from Costcutter to further develop its retail business.

    “I’m very pleased to be aligning my business with CSG,” Morar commented. “I’ve been particularly impressed with their partnership approach to business development and the wealth of expertise they can bring to our group.

    “My team and I are excited for the future of our partnership and to already be working collaboratively on a number of new opportunities.”

    Costcutter said plans are already underway to expand the partnership with the potential for more sites to be brought onboard under the agreement before the end of 2020 and into 2021.

    Jamie Davison, CSG business development director, added: “SRG is a progressive and well-respected group and we are delighted to announce this new partnership. Partnering with Mital and his team is testament to our leading offer and levels of support which will enable SRG to respond to and thrive in today’s challenging market. We are looking forward to supporting them as they further develop and expand their unique retail offering.”
